    A little background.
    I'm a dance instructor. I was hoping to do a salsa bootcamp today. It was a total disaster. No one from my extremely successful Facebook ad campaign showed up.

    Previously I did two VERY successful events, WITHOUT ANY Facebook advertising. For those events, I promoted on Facebook groups' walls. Groups like Houston Events and Things to do around Houston. I got about 50 interested people and a half dozen RSVPs. The first event (a beginning bootcamp) I had 35 people attend! The second (an intermediate bootcamp) I had 30.

    With this event I wanted to push for more success. I was worried that I had exhausted my welcome on those groups so I decided to supplement my marketing strategy with a facebook ad. In addition to my previous marketing strategy I ran a 4 day add with $11 a day budget. It was in my judgment extremely successful.

    All told 118 people said they were interested in the event, which as extremely exciting. But only 11 people said they were coming, which was worrying because of the low level of commitment and also because almost all of them were from my Facebook friends list. Furthermore I only sold 1 online evenbrite ticket, as opposed to the previous 7 or 5.

    But I was still very optimistic because of the extremely high interest level. I figured if two people from that 118, that would pay for the Facebook ad. But I was expecting at least 20, considering the success from my past events.

    To keep people interested I created posts as reminders to the event wall. What to wear. What to expect the next day. Things like that. Didn't help. Each post was only seen by 6 or 7 people.

    I sent a reminder private message to the friends who said they were going.

    I tried EVERYTHING to make sure this event was a success.

    5 people showed up, NONE of them from the Facebook ad. Every single one of them were personal friends or they came from my Facebook friends list.

    What did I do wrong?

    These are the things that were different between the 3 events:
    * This event was later in the day. 4pm instead of 2pm.
    * I charged $5 more at the door and online.
    * I supplemented my marketing strategy with Facebook advertising to target an interested audience.

    I am at complete loss as to how this event failed.

    First question. When you filled out your targeting, did you exclude all the "spam" engagement countries? It doesn't matter where you live and what your targeting is, if you don't exclude countries like India or Egypt, you will receive tons of "spam" engagement, also registrations. If this is the case, next time, try to make sure you exclude spammy regions.
